About Frontier-Kemper Excellence in Underground and Heavy Civil Construction Frontier-Kemper-Tutor Perini joint venture was awarded the Manhattan Tunnel Project, part of the Hudson Tunnel Project (HTP). A $1.18 billion design-build contract from the Gateway Development Commission for the HTP which aims to enhance rail resiliency by adding two new tracks between New York and New Jersey and rehabilitating the storm-damaged North River Tunnel. The project includes designing and constructing twin 30-foot diameter, 700-foot-long tunnels under the Hudson River, connecting to existing tunnels beneath Hudson Yards, and an access shaft at 12th Avenue, later serving as a ventilation facility.
